From: Nam Cao Date: Wed, 5 Feb 2025 10:46:33 +0000 (+0100) Subject: ALSA: Switch to use hrtimer_setup() X-Git-Tag: v6.14-rc4~25^2~10 X-Git-Url: http://git.ipfire.org/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=70e90680c2592c38c62e5716f1296a2d74bae7af;p=thirdparty%2Flinux.git ALSA: Switch to use hrtimer_setup() hrtimer_setup() takes the callback function pointer as argument and initializes the timer completely. Replace hrtimer_init() and the open coded initialization of hrtimer::function with the new setup mechanism. Patch was created by using Coccinelle.
